The Core Principles of Sustainable Outdoor Design

Sustainable outdoor design begins with a deep understanding of your specific environment and a commitment to working with nature, not against it. This foundational approach ensures longevity and ecological balance.

Understanding Your Site's Ecosystem

Before a single plant is chosen, truly sustainable outdoor design requires an in-depth analysis of your site. This includes understanding sunlight patterns, soil composition, drainage, existing vegetation, and local climate. Mapping these elements allows for informed decisions, minimizing resource use and maximizing a garden's natural potential. Identifying microclimates within your property can open up opportunities for a wider variety of plantings.

Embracing Biodiversity and Native Plantings

A cornerstone of eco-friendly garden layouts is the promotion of biodiversity. This means selecting plants that provide food and habitat for local wildlife, from pollinators to beneficial insects. Native plants are particularly crucial as they are adapted to the regional climate and soil, requiring less water, fertilizer, and pest control once established. They also support the local ecosystem more effectively than exotic species.

Water-Wise Strategies: Beyond Drip Irrigation

Water conservation is critical for sustainable outdoor design. While drip irrigation is a good start, modern approaches go further. This includes rainwater harvesting systems, rain gardens that capture and filter stormwater runoff, and the strategic use of permeable paving materials that allow water to infiltrate the ground rather than becoming runoff.

Smart Water Management Integration

A key differentiator in today's eco-friendly garden layouts is the integration of smart irrigation technology. Beyond simple timers, these systems use real-time weather data, soil moisture sensors, and plant-specific needs to precisely deliver water, often reducing usage by 30-50%. This not only conserves a precious resource but also ensures your plants receive optimal hydration, leading to healthier growth. Soil Health: The Foundation of Life

Healthy soil is the bedrock of any thriving garden, especially in sustainable outdoor design. Building vibrant soil rich in organic matter improves water retention, aeration, and nutrient availability, reducing the need for synthetic fertilizers. Composting kitchen and yard waste is an excellent way to amend soil naturally, creating a self-sustaining nutrient cycle. Prioritizing healthy soil fosters a robust root system, making plants more resilient.

Material Selection: Recycled, Local, and Low-Impact

The materials used in your garden layout significantly impact its ecological footprint. Opt for materials that are recycled, locally sourced, or have a low embodied energy (the energy consumed by their production and transportation). Examples include reclaimed wood for decking, permeable pavers made from recycled content, or local stone for pathways. Conscious material choices contribute to a truly sustainable landscape.

Pollinator Gardens: Supporting Local Wildlife

Designing specifically for pollinators is a crucial aspect of eco-friendly garden layouts. Incorporate a variety of flowering plants that provide nectar and pollen throughout the seasons. This supports bees, butterflies, hummingbirds, and other beneficial insects, which are vital for ecosystem health. Creating pollinator pathways enhances the ecological value of urban and suburban landscapes.

Edible Landscapes and Food Forests

Integrating edible plants into your design allows for fresh produce while enhancing the ecological function of your garden. From herb spirals to fruit trees and berry bushes, edible landscapes can be both productive and visually appealing. The concept of a "food forest" takes this further, mimicking natural ecosystems with layers of edible plants that are self-sustaining over time.

Maintenance for a Thriving Eco-Garden

Sustainable gardens are often described as "low maintenance," but they are not "no maintenance." They require a different kind of care: monitoring soil health, observing plant needs, and occasionally refreshing mulch. The shift is from intensive intervention (e.g., constant mowing, chemical spraying) to nurturing ecological processes and allowing nature to do much of the work. Frequently Asked Questions

Q: What are the absolute first steps for a beginner looking to create an eco-friendly garden? A: Start by observing your space. Note sunlight patterns, existing plants, and drainage. Test your soil to understand its composition and pH. Research native plants suitable for your specific region and microclimate. Begin small with a single bed or section, focusing on improving soil and selecting water-wise, native species to build confidence.

Q: Is sustainable outdoor design significantly more expensive than traditional landscaping? A: Initial costs for specific sustainable materials or advanced irrigation might be slightly higher. However, sustainable outdoor design typically offers substantial long-term savings through reduced water bills, minimal need for fertilizers and pesticides, and less frequent plant replacement due to better plant adaptation. It's an investment that pays off both financially and environmentally.

Q: Can I still use some non-native plants in my eco-friendly garden layout? A: Yes, absolutely! The goal is not exclusion but balance. Aim for a significant majority (e.g., 70-80%) of native and climate-adapted plants to support local ecosystems. You can strategically incorporate a few non-invasive, drought-tolerant, or cherished non-native plants for specific aesthetic or sentimental reasons, ensuring they don't outcompete native species.

Q: How can I make my garden more attractive to pollinators and local wildlife? A: Focus on providing a diverse range of native plants that offer food (nectar, pollen, seeds) throughout the seasons. Include a water source, such as a shallow bird bath. Create shelter with dense shrubs, log piles, or "insect hotels." Avoid pesticides, and consider leaving a small area of your garden a little wild to provide natural habitats.
